    For an IPTV player I've tried:

    IPTV (Alexander Sofronov)
    IPTV Extreme
    Perfect Player IPTV
    Lazy IPTV
    Smart IPTV

    I find the Alexander Sofronov one of the best / most useable. Supports pausing without a backend and loads quickly. Purchased to Pro version.

    I have the Shield and a Sony Android TV. I'm going to use TVIRL to integrate a selection of IPTV channels into the TV epg, then use the IPTV app on the Shield for the rest.

  • Closed Accounts Posts: 4,456 ✭✭✭The high horse brigade


    You have no need to root the shield or install a custom launcher in a Shield. There's no bloat and the homescreen is customisable, you can turn off whatever you don't want showing.

    If you want to block ads across your network for all devices get pihole.
